KARACHI: Promotion of fisheries sector pledged



By Our Staff Reporter


KARACHI, Oct 12: Adviser to the Chief Minister on Fisheries and Livestock Faqir Mohammad Jadam Mangrio, who is also Chairman of the Karachi Fish Harbour Authority, has said that the government is keen to promote the fisheries sector and, for this purpose, taking effective measures to solve the problems being faced by the seafood industry.

Mr Mangrio said he had directed the KFHA MD to accelerate the work on the K-2 Auction Hall so that it could be put into operation soon after the upcoming Eidul Fitr.

He paid a surprise visit to the harbour and inspected the conditions prevailing there. At the KFHA head office, he chaired a meeting to review overall performance of the Authority, and stressed the need for improving the same.
